Crawfish Étouffée

If you visit Shreveport, Louisiana, you must try crawfish étouffée. This classic Cajun dish is a local favorite and sure to please. To make this dish, a roux, crawfish tails, onions, celery, and bell peppers are sautéed in butter. The mixture is then boiled until the flavors merge, creating a rich, delicious sauce served over fluffy white rice.

Despite its simplicity, the meal’s flavor is complex. The crawfish is juicy and tender, and the sauce’s spices blend well. After eating, you’ll feel full and satisfied because it’s a big dinner.

Red Beans & Rice

Red beans and rice are Southern staples recognized for their simplicity and flavor. Red beans, onions, celery, and spices are simmered over low heat for many hours and served over rice to make the word. This simple but flavorful Louisiana dish is an excellent example of home cuisine.

The dish often comes with fried chicken or cornbread in Shreveport. It’s the kind of dish that satisfies for hours.

Jambalaya

In Shreveport, you must eat jambalaya. Louisiana residents eat this dish often. This recipe cooks rice with various meats, fish, veggies, and spices in one pot. The supper is delicious and full, making it excellent for serving numerous people.

Jambalaya in Shreveport usually has chicken, shrimp, and sausage. It may contain shrimp. Most restaurants serve the meal for lunch or dinner with cornbread or French bread.

Immerse Yourself in Art: Discover the R.W. Norton Gallery, a Hidden Gem of Shreveport

Shreveport art lovers should visit the R.W. Norton Art Gallery. Its European and American art collection makes this museum a treasure trove. Everyone’s covered. Guests can learn about Renaissance, Baroque, and contemporary art in one stunning location.

The R.W. Norton Art Gallery is more than a museum—it celebrates all art forms. The collection includes around four thousand paintings, sculptures, and decorative arts from hundreds of years of artistic expression. Rembrandt, Monet, and Degas are the famous artists in the collection. The collection also includes works by lesser-known painters who contributed significantly to art.

Teaching and community service set the R.W. Norton Art Gallery apart. The museum offers many activities and events to engage visitors and foster an appreciation for the arts. Art classes, workshops, talks, seminars, and family events are continually happening at the R.W. Norton Art Gallery.
